The ingredients needed to make Puran poli:
  1. Make ready 1 cup maida
  2. Take 2 tbsp Fine rawa
  3. Get 1 cup approx chana dal
  4. Take to taste jaggery according
  5. Prepare As per taste cardamom and nutmeg powder
  6. Prepare 4 tbsp oil
  7. Take pinch salt

Instructions to make Puran poli:
  1. Mix salt, maida and suji make a dough with water and oil. keep aside
  2. Boil chana dal for 3 whistles in low flame. After that add jaggery, so daal will be little watery. cook till the water evaporates. Add cardamom and nutmeg powder.
  3. Make a small roti then stuff the filling and make a chapati.
  4. Cook both sides till done.
